Pranburi is a sleepy seaside resort south of Hua Hin near the entrance to Khao
Sam Roi Yot National Park.
An intriguing side trip can be made to Ban Khun Tanot, a traditional Thai
fishing village that exists where nature refuses to survive. Khun Tanot lies in
a bizarre decomposed marsh of sculpted clay, eerie black birds, and thousands of
charred trees that stand like forgotten skeletons in a life less land. The
surrealistic scene may jog your memory: the Killing Fields in the war movie of
the same title.
